The FM broadcast in the United States starts at 88.0 MHz and ends at 108.0 MHz . The band is divided into 100 channels, each 200 kHz (0.2 MHz) wide.

Read moreHow is the spectrum allocated in Canada?
In Canada, ISED manages spectrum (except the spectrum used for broadcasting, which is managed by the Canadian Radio-television and Telecommunications Commission [CRTC]) using primarily a first-come, first-served approach to assign frequencies and issue licences.
Read moreWhich US government agency agencies are responsible for regulation of the electromagnetic spectrum?
The FCC is responsible for managing and licensing the electromagnetic spectrum for commercial users and for non-commercial users including: state, county and local governments.
